Weather elements
- North Tunisia and Gulf of Hammamet: West/North West wind, force 7 Beaufort (28 to 33 knots).
- Chebba and Gulf of Gabès: East/North East wind, force 7 Beaufort (28 to 33 knots).
Generative phenomenon and evolution
Depression 1005 hPa over the Gulf of Genoa deepening and shifting towards the Adriatic Sea expected at 999hPa, subsequently associated with a depression 1000 hPa over southern Tunisia-Algeria.
